Ugh. Ladder anxiety! That's really not how it works. The game never tries to "get you back to 50% win rate". It tries to get you a game in which you'll have 50% to win right now.
If you overshot your rank, you will likely lose a few because your team will be weaker everytime, but if you got better, the game doesn't give you impossible games to hit that magical 50% winrate.
The matchmaking has some glaring flaws in this game (and most games, really), but that isn't one of them.
